ol
28.09.2017
06:19:27
читай доку, есть там все
Artem
28.09.2017
06:19:52
Ок, ещё раз пройдусь, спасибо
ol
28.09.2017
06:21:01
кто знает, где удаленку найти ?
типа миниподработку
Google
Artem
28.09.2017
06:47:47
Upwork пробовал?
По поводу Fosuserbundle. Прошелся по доке. В доке показано только как сделать взаимодействие user->role через бд. А чтобы можно было пермишены подключать к role не показано. ol sm, если не сложно, кинь ссылку где это в доке описывается.
Artemiy
28.09.2017
11:12:44
Вместо permission_id я бы имя использовал
Можно smallint
ol
28.09.2017
11:13:26
Вы что хотите, сделать?
Artem
28.09.2017
11:26:14
Artemiy
28.09.2017
11:26:25
Там же
Artem
28.09.2017
11:26:36
Пермишен - это должна быть отдельная сущносьь
Artemiy
28.09.2017
11:27:02
Я бы не делал отдельной сущностью
Ты хочешь их динамически создавать?
Artem
28.09.2017
11:27:52
Artemiy
28.09.2017
11:28:27
Можешь пример кеййса привести?
Google
Artem
28.09.2017
13:01:32
Есть роль админ с каким-то кратким описанием роли. И есть пермишн update-post с кратким описанием "просмотр постов". И админ сайта может определять назначать этой роли пермишн или нет.
Artemiy
28.09.2017
13:10:14
update-post типо динамически ставится?
я думаю они у тебя итак известны все
ol
28.09.2017
13:10:30
yt
не
у него другое
он хочет сделать, назначение прав, для каждой роли
Artemiy
28.09.2017
13:11:29
так прав для каждой роли это понятно
Artem
28.09.2017
13:11:38
Чуваки, я чуть позже скину схему бд. А то я так понял я непонятно обьясняю
Artemiy
28.09.2017
13:11:40
я имею ввиду - зачем динамически пермишены сами создавать
))
ol
28.09.2017
13:14:26
нахер пых, переходит на свифт ))
Alexandr
28.09.2017
13:14:28
ol
28.09.2017
13:15:00
JMSSecurityExtraBundle есть такая штука ! Подтверждаю !
Alexandr
28.09.2017
13:15:31
К слову, наверное самая адекватная схема проверки, но поддерживать ее очень муторно. У нас Аналити постоянно ныли и фигачили тикеты в трекер, мол то не работает или это, а там тупо забывали чекнуть разрешение
Artem
28.09.2017
13:16:11
Alexandr
28.09.2017
13:16:11
но там реально просто делается полноценная безопасность для demo ?
ol
28.09.2017
13:16:45
Сань, Realm Mobile Database, юзал ?
Artem
28.09.2017
13:16:58
Да, я тоже считаю что это самая нормальная система авторизации
Alexandr
28.09.2017
13:18:27
Google
ol
28.09.2017
13:19:00
а для больших данных, что использоавть ?
Alexandr
28.09.2017
13:19:01
ol
28.09.2017
13:19:14
что-то меня не вдохновляется джейсоном общаться
Alexandr
28.09.2017
13:19:33
ol
28.09.2017
13:20:16
и этот человек, мне говорил, будь в тренде ))
интересно, все приложения юзают локальные БД с большим объемом информации
или все по АПИ общаются ?
Artem
28.09.2017
13:22:57
Смотря какая архитектура
И какие требования к проекту
ol
28.09.2017
13:23:24
я про ios сейчас говорю
ожидается к примеру 500к записей
и че realm нафиг ?
Artem
28.09.2017
13:23:50
На ios не кодил)
ol
28.09.2017
13:25:24
я чисто логически хочу это дерьмо понять
локальные базы для оффлайн
а как быть, блять, с онлайн ?
Alexandr
28.09.2017
13:25:55
на мобильнике
ol
28.09.2017
13:26:18
ну coredata и realm могут отдельно стоять, так же ? или нет
или я тупой
Google
Alexandr
28.09.2017
13:27:09
мы вываливаемся за тему канала :) Этот вопрос лучше решать в канали свифта, если есть такой - там просто больше специалистов
ol
28.09.2017
13:27:16
CoreData и Realm созданы для работы с большим поток данных, это я знаю
Alexandr
28.09.2017
13:27:25
А тут мы тычем пальцем в небо
ol
28.09.2017
13:28:03
в чем проблема, развеять мозги ?
Valentin
28.09.2017
14:31:58
Это, вроде бы, то что ты ищешь: создал группы, присвоил им роли, а потом насовал туда пользователей
Users, authors, moderators, admins, и т.п.
Admin
ol
28.09.2017
14:38:32
ему права нужна раздавать для пользователей и групп
Valentin
28.09.2017
14:39:37
Если перевести его терминологию в фосовскую, то permission -> role, role -> group
И всё встаёт на свои места
ol
28.09.2017
14:39:54
ему это уже все объяснили
Artem
28.09.2017
14:45:51
Угу) но все равно спасибо что отозвался
Ladone
30.09.2017
20:54:30
Как с помощью FormData, можно сделать серриализацию, или передать как json на сервер?
Гружу фотографию на сервер через ajax, а там такая чушь...
Dima
30.09.2017
21:10:31
проверял через json_last_error ?
Ladone
30.09.2017
21:15:06
там ошибок нету, там просто данные в таком вот виде
var form = new FormData();
var urlPhoto = URL.createObjectURL(photo); // photo — один файл, там выше юзается фурыч.
$.ajax({
url: '{{ path('upload_photo_galery', {id: coworking.id}) }}',
method: 'POST',
async: false,
processData: false,
data: form,
success: function(data)
{
$('#upload-'+indexUploaded).find('img').remove();
$('#upload-'+indexUploaded).append(objGalery);
}
});
Alan
30.09.2017
21:16:44
разве FormData не form-url-encoded передавать будет ?
а у тебя content-type: image/png
Ladone
30.09.2017
21:21:33
заменил, но все равно, не помогло.
Google
Artem
30.09.2017
21:38:43
что у тебя у запроса в заголовке content-type?
ol
30.09.2017
22:02:12
это что такое ?
Big_Shark
30.09.2017
23:36:12
Кто флекс пробовал? Что скажете?
Aleksandr
01.10.2017
05:58:04
я пробовал
я бы сказал - ну такое
Big_Shark
01.10.2017
09:01:50
Aleksandr
01.10.2017
09:02:18
ну я месяца 4 назад смотрел
Big_Shark
01.10.2017
09:13:18
Artemiy
02.10.2017
09:56:36
Ребята, всем привет
Tex
02.10.2017
09:57:04
Драсте
Artemiy
02.10.2017
09:57:09
Думаю как сделать, может наведет кто на мысль.
В контроллер приходят параметры. Дальше эти параметры идут в сервис, который создает и возвращает нужный энтити. Вопрос в том, где и как лучше валидировать такие параметры?
Alexandr
02.10.2017
11:18:47
@artemiylapko , инжекти валидатор в контроллер и проверяй.
Еще можно через ParamConverter - там можно получить сущность и уже в экшен придет не набор параметров или запрос, а полноценная сущность. Там же можно заинжектить в экшен и параметры валидации.
как-то так
там куча вариантов, к слову.